The government has reinstated Md Kohinoor Mian, former deputy commissioner (west) of the Dhaka Metropolitan Police (DMP), cancelling a previous order that had dismissed him from service. According to the notification, Kohinoor Mian had been dismissed from service following two departmental cases filed against him. However, he was later acquitted by the court in two criminal cases filed over the same allegations. Subsequently, the President approved a petition seeking reconsideration of the major punishment, leading to the cancellation of his dismissal order. As a result, the notification regarding his dismissal issued on February 22, 2011 has been revoked, and the period of his dismissal will now be considered part of his official service.
